QuietComfort 25. Bose QuietComfort 25 with mounted 3.5 mm headphone jack, and carry case. The "QuietComfort 25" (QC25) over-ear headphones were sold from 2014 until 2019. The "QuietComfort 25" (QC25) over-ear headphones were released in 2014 [ 36] as the replacement for the QuietComfort 15.
QuietComfort 20. The "QuietComfort 20" (QC20) and QC20i in-ear headphones were released in 2015 and are the company's first in-ear noise cancelling headphones. Subhas Chandra Bose (/ ʃ ʊ b ˈ h ɑː s ˈ tʃ ʌ n d r ə ˈ b oʊ s / ⓘ shuub-HAHSS CHUN-drə BOHSS; [12] 23 January 1897 – 18 August 1945) was an Indian nationalist whose defiance of British authority in India made him a hero among many Indians, but his wartime alliances with Nazi Germany and Imperial Japan left a legacy vexed by authoritarianism, anti-Semitism, and military failure.
